Exclusive Interview – Star Wars Jedi: Battle Scars author Sam Maggs

March 16, 2023 by Ricky Church

Ricky Church talks Star Wars with Sam Maggs, author of the Star Wars Jedi: Survivor prequel novel Star Wars Jedi: Battle Scars…

With Star Wars Jedi: Survivor set for release at the end of April, fans can get a look at what Cal Kestis and the crew of the Stinger Mantis have been up to since the conclusion of Jedi: Fallen Order in the lead-in novel Star Wars Jedi: Battle Scars, written by author, video game and comics writer Sam Maggs.

Maggs has had an extensive career in writing, primarily writing for video games such as Call of Duty: Vanguard, Anthem and the Spider-Man DLC The City That Never Sleeps. On the comics front, she has written Captain Marvel, IDW’s Transformers/My Little Pony crossover and a graphic novel adaptation of Fangirl. She has been a huge fan of the galaxy far, far away nearly all her life which, coupled with her love of and experience in video games, made Star Wars Jedi: Battle Scars an exciting project to work on.

Our discussion touched on adapting the setting of Jedi to a novel, capturing the perspectives of each character and Maggs’ experience writing in such vastly different genres.
